Chicago, IL – An early onset of spring-like weather, set to continue for the entire week. 

The National Weather Service has reported a trend of unseasonably mild temperatures, with highs consistently in the 40s and even touching the 50-degree mark, a stark contrast to the expected cold of a typical Chicago winter. 

This extended period of warmth, accompanied by dry conditions, offers a respite from the heavy coats and scarves usually donned by residents this time of year.
